‘How I Met Your Mother’: John Lithgow to play Barney’s father

Call it “How I Met My Father.” John Lithgow will guest star as Barney’s (Neil Patrick Harris) father in an upcoming episode of “How I Met Your Mother,” CBS confirms.

Lithgow will appear in an episode airing around the end of February. Barney made the decision that he was ready to meet his father in an episode earlier this month. While it’s not the fantasy casting of “Mad Men’s” John Slattery that Showtracker discussed with executive producer Craig Thomas last October, the former “3rd Rock From the Sun” star’s comedy chops should fit right in on “HIMYM.” He also had quite the killer streak on ‘Dexter,’ which caused “HIMYM” co-star Cobie Smulders to joke about being terrified of Lithgow on TV Guide Network’s “Hollywood 411.”

“It’s really exciting and different for our show,” she said. “He’s such a pioneer.’

It’s been a big week for Barney. Earlier this week, he also got a new love interest.
